你查询的IP:[60.63.241.11]  地理位置:中国–上海–上海电信/东方有线

最新查询124.20.251.5 134.196.14.166 116.70.89.10 124.42.121.132 121.16.221.111 222.248.252.45 116.1.55.53 219.82.61.57 114.60.148.3 60.63.241.11 117.21.9.249 61.29.128.204 121.56.79.184 116.60.114.180 117.103.128.25 202.95.252.115 121.68.218.135 116.2.38.11 203.128.96.128 222.64.215.108 221.198.68.174 221.200.249.116 203.187.160.97 116.112.2.154 122.102.178.167 218.38.118.206 118.228.64.251 202.127.160.241 203.99.80.67 117.48.138.98 117.22.95.39